Currency in Colombia Colombian peso (COP). For 10 US dollars you can get 41.8 thousand Colombian pesos. For 100 US dollars you can get 418 thousand Colombian pesos. And the other way around: For 100 Colombian pesos you can get 0.0239 US dollars.


Generally, it is much cheaper in Colombia than in United States. Food is 59% cheaper. Dining in restaurants and bars will be cheaper by 66%. In turn, the cost of living in Bogota is lower than the cost in United States by 52%. If we want to spend time actively or to have fun, we will pay less than in United States about 57%.

Can you eat cheaply in restaurants in Bogota? What are the prices in affordable pubs in Bogota? How much will I have to spend a day when I only eat in fast food restaurants in Bogota?

If we are looking for an inexpensive place to eat, we should expect to pay around 4.8 US dollars. With limited time and to avoid spending too much, you can opt for fast food. The cost of a meal set (sandwich, fries, and a soda) is approximately 6.7 US dollars. And when we can afford to go out to the restaurant, we'll pay for a three-course meal around 26 US dollars. And if you want to drink a beer or two, you have to pay extra: 2.2 US dollars (price for 2 bottles) And if you prefer a Coke, Fanta, Sprite or similar carbonated drink, then you have to pay 0.79 US dollars for a small bottle.

Food Prices Bogota

  1. Milk (regular), 1 liter $1.2 (COP 5.16K)
  2. A loaf of fresh white bread (500g) $1.3 (COP 5.49K)
  3. Eggs (regular) (12) $2.1 (COP 8.73K)
  4. Local Cheese (1kg) $4.5 (COP 18.8K)
  5. Water (1.5 liter bottle) $0.77 (COP 3.23K)
  6. A bottle of wine (mid-range) $8.4 (COP 35K)
  7. Local Beer (0.5 liter bottle) $1 (COP 4.26K)
  8. Imported Beer (0.33 liter bottle) $1.9 (COP 7.9K)
  9. Pack of Cigarettes (Marlboro) $2.3 (COP 9.5K)
  10. Chicken breasts (skinless and boneless) - (1kg) $5 (COP 21.1K)
  11. Apples (1kg) $2.5 (COP 10.5K)
  12. Oranges (1kg) $1.1 (COP 4.81K)
  13. Potatoes (1kg) $0.96 (COP 4.01K)
  14. Lettuce (1 head) $0.74 (COP 3.11K)
  15. Kilo of white rice $1.2 (COP 5.15K)
  16. Tomatoes (1kg) $1.3 (COP 5.5K)
  17. Bananas (1kg) $1.1 (COP 4.7K)
  18. Onions (1kg) $0.97 (COP 4.07K)
  19. Beef (1kg) (or similar red meat) $7.5 (COP 31.3K)

Prices In Restaurants Bogota

  1. Meal in a cheap restaurant $4.8 (COP 20K)
  2. Meal for 2 People, Mid-range Restaurant, Three-course $26 (COP 110K)
  3. McMeal at McDonald's (or Equivalent Combo Meal) $6.7 (COP 28K)
  4. Domestic Beer (0.5 liter draught) $1.1 (COP 4.5K)
  5. Imported Beer (0.33 liter bottle) $2.4 (COP 10K)
  6. Coke/Pepsi (0.33 liter bottle) $0.79 (COP 3.3K)
  7. Water (0.33 liter bottle) $0.63 (COP 2.63K)
  8. Cappuccino $1.5 (COP 6.27K)

Cost Of Living Bogota

  1. One-way Ticket (Local Transport) $0.72 (COP 3K)
  2. Monthly Pass (Regular Price) $37 (COP 155K)
  3. Gasoline (1 liter) $0.92 (COP 3.84K)
  4. Volkswagen Golf 1.4 90 KW (or equivalent new car) $14.4K (COP 60M)
  5. Apartment (1 bedroom) in city centre $432 (COP 1.81M)
  6. Apartment (1 bedroom) outside of centre $299 (COP 1.25M)
  7. Apartment (3 bedrooms) in city centre $661 (COP 2.76M)
  8. Apartment (3 bedrooms) outside of centre $554 (COP 2.32M)
  9. Utilities (electricity, heating, water, garbage) for an 85m2 apartment $98 (COP 408K)
  10. Internet (60 Mbps or more, unlimited data, cable/ADSL) $26 (COP 109K)
  11. numb_34 $9.6 (COP 39.9K)
  12. 1 pair of jeans (Levis 501 or similar) $50 (COP 209K)
  13. 1 Summer Dress in a Chain Store (Zara, H&M,...) $40 (COP 167K)
  14. 1 pair of Nike running shoes or similar $82 (COP 341K)
  15. 1 pair of men's leather shoes $71 (COP 295K)
  16. Toyota Corolla 1.6l, 97kW Comfort (or equivalent new car) $22.8K (COP 95.3M)
  17. Preschool (or Kindergarten), Private, Monthly for 1 Child $212 (COP 885K)
  18. Price per square meter for an apartment in the city center $1.8K (COP 7.54M)
  19. International Primary School, Annually for 1 Child $6.83K (COP 28.6M)
  20. Price per square meter for an apartment outside of city centre $1.3K (COP 5.44M)
  21. Average Monthly Net Salary (After Tax) $352 (COP 1.47M)
  22. Mortgage annual interest rate in percentages (%) 14%
  23. Taxi starting fare (normal tariff) $1.3 (COP 5.5K)
  24. Taxi 1km (Normal Tariff) $1.5 (COP 6.12K)
  25. Taxi 1 hour waiting (normal tariff) $4.3 (COP 18K)

Entertainment Costs Bogota

  1. Fitness Club, Monthly Fee for 1 Adult $22 (COP 91.3K)
  2. Tennis court rental (1 hour during a weekend) $9.1 (COP 38.1K)
  3. Cinema, Single Ticket $4.8 (COP 20K)
